Definitions

n.

A point of land projecting into the sea; a short, sleeveless cloak worn over the shoulders.

海角,岬;披肩,短斗篷

v.

To wave a cape to attract or direct a bull; to keep a course.

挥动斗篷引导(牛);保持航向
